Warning Signs You Need Concrete Water Damage Restoration

Catching Issues Early: Identifying the warning signs of concrete water damage can save you time, money, and a lot of stress. Don’t ignore these subtle signs; they can show a more significant problem brewing beneath the surface.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Indications of Moisture: If you notice persistent musty smells in your home, it may be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ore these odors; they can show a serious issue that needs attention.

Stains and Discoloration

Early Warning Signs: If you notice unusual stains or discoloration on your concrete floors or walls, it may be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the cause and provide the necessary repairs.

Cracks and Gaps

Structural Concerns: If you notice cracks or gaps in your concrete, it may be a sign of structural damage. Don’t delay; our team can help you assess the damage and provide the necessary repairs to ensure your home’s safety and integrity.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Early Warning Signs: If you notice warped or buckled flooring, it may be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the cause and provide the necessary repairs to restore your floors to their original condition.

Concrete Water Damage Restoration Cost In Ottumwa, IA

The cost of concrete water damage restoration in Ottumwa, IA,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here’s a rough estimate of the costs involved: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Dehumidification and Drying $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of sanitizer used
Repair and Finishing $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ials used

Keep in mind that these estimates are rough and may vary depending on your specific situation. Contact us for a free consultation and a customized estimate for your concrete water damage restoration needs.
